Hi,

I want to power the FRDM-K64F from a shield, and I was wondering if the P5V_USB can be used to power the board.

It seems to work fine, however I was wondering if there any disadvantages to use the P5V_USB pin instead of the P5-9V_Vin pin?

Hello Anders,

There is no major disadvantage. Here I would just be careful and make sure you are not exceeding 5V if you choose to use the P5V_USB. Checking the schematic I noticed that VREGIN can receive this voltage and in the datasheet it states that it can stand up to 5.5V. If you need this in your application just be mindful as it is dangerous to work in the limit of the specifications.
